Output 0379530cf8407c4febee18af4a4ddbd2f3a8cb676c43a42102e0720bd72de91a: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3f94f6df52e4490486b9ee220ec188bb2dffd20 OP_EQUALVERIFY OP_CHECKSIG
address
1PF1rzn2MzNTyfiRoxnLGyfztVQUhFS8iC
transaction
0379530cf8407c4febee18af4a4ddbd2f3a8cb676c43a42102e0720bd72de91a
confirmations
637667
spent
true